Premium, architect designed two-story townhome on a unique, wooded, one-acre property. Enjoy living in tranquility among nature, yet still close-in to Downtown Portland, Forest Park, shops, gyms, hospitals, and public transportation. Nature parks and trails right outside your front door.
Less than a 15-minute drive to NW 23rd/Downtown Portland, Nike, Intel, St Vincent's, OHSU, Legacy, and Providence hospitals.
Nestled in a favorite Portland suburb, the Cedar Mill neighborhood is named by Travel+Leisure's Top 10 best places to live in Oregon.

Bright, Cozy Unit in NW Portland
My partner and I stayed here for several months and had a great experience. The unit is in a safe suburban neighborhood, but has quick access to downtown Portland or Beaverton. The property itself is quiet and tucked away in the trees with a park and wooded trails across the street. The neighbors were friendly, and there was always plenty of street parking. The location is perfect for healthcare travelers working in east or central Portland. It is about a 17-minute drive to OHSU and 10 minutes to Providence St. Vincent Medical center. The space is cozy with tons of windows and natural light. The unit was well-equipped with everything we needed for cooking and cleaning, and had plenty of closet space for clothing and belongings. We appreciated the comfy, high quality mattresses and the guest room came in handy when we had family visit. Kim was very responsive throughout our stay.
